late: Urdu meaning

#late, #later, #latest
jisay dayr ho gai ho / dayr se / akhiri hissay me / marhuum
1. Definitions: (adjective)
1. near the end of a period of time such as a year, season, part of the day, etc. or near the end of someone's life, or career
2. near or at the end of the day
3. someone who his dead, especially one who has died recently
4. happening, arriving, or done after the planned, expected, usual or normal time
5. of the immediate past or just previous to the present time
6. too late: if it is too late to do something, it is useless or ineffective to do because it happens after the best time for it


2. Definitions: (adverb)
1. after the planned, arranged, or expected time
2. after the correct or usual time
3. near the end of a day, year, or other period of time
4. near the end of an event, a person's life, etc.
5. until after the usual time or hour
6. of late: (formal) recently; in recent times
7. late of: (formal) having lived or worked in a particular place or institution until recently, but not
now; formerly
8. late in the day: too late to do something, because it will not be effective or of no use now
9. better late than never: (saying)


Example Sentences:
1. I'm rarely late for school. (1.4)
2. The bus was late. (1.4)
3. He married in his late forties. (1)
4. He was in his late fifties when he died. (1.1)
5. my late and beloved wife (1.3)
6. a late night movie (1.2)
7. It's not too late. You can still change your mind. (1.6)
